Output 84fc86113744b8803b2ac351056f5102a4ac1d8fc51a6c5436d52c5a0c0cf562:0

value
18657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7880b69ca9a6f39b2f302b04f1e0a23acda048 OP_EQUAL
address
34ZREAs6gCrB36EXKbvYj6wC3216Y76QWR
transaction
84fc86113744b8803b2ac351056f5102a4ac1d8fc51a6c5436d52c5a0c0cf562
spent
true